Skip to content

Commit ffc258d

Browse files
chore(deps): replace oauth2-server (#35085)
1 parent 5473e35 commit ffc258d

File tree

4 files changed

+31
-69
lines changed

4 files changed

+31
-69
lines changed

apps/meteor/package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-225,6 +225,7 @@
225225
"@nivo/heatmap": "0.88.0",
226226
"@nivo/line": "0.88.0",
227227
"@nivo/pie": "0.88.0",
228+
"@node-oauth/oauth2-server": "5.2.0",
228229
"@opentelemetry/api": "^1.9.0",
229230
"@opentelemetry/exporter-trace-otlp-grpc": "^0.54.2",
230231
"@opentelemetry/sdk-node": "^0.54.2",
@@ -392,7 +393,6 @@
392393
"node-gcm": "1.1.4",
393394
"node-rsa": "^1.1.1",
394395
"nodemailer": "^6.9.16",
395-
"oauth2-server": "3.1.1",
396396
"object-path": "^0.11.8",
397397
"path": "^0.12.7",
398398
"path-to-regexp": "^6.3.0",

apps/meteor/server/oauth2-server/model.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,3 @@
1-
import { OAuthApps, OAuthAuthCodes, OAuthAccessTokens, OAuthRefreshTokens } from '@rocket.chat/models';
21
import type {
32
AuthorizationCode,
43
AuthorizationCodeModel,
@@ -8,7 +7,8 @@ import type {
87
RefreshTokenModel,
98
Token,
109
User,
11-
} from 'oauth2-server';
10+
} from '@node-oauth/oauth2-server';
11+
import { OAuthApps, OAuthAuthCodes, OAuthAccessTokens, OAuthRefreshTokens } from '@rocket.chat/models';
1212

1313
export type ModelConfig = {
1414
debug?: boolean;

apps/meteor/server/oauth2-server/oauth.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,8 @@
1+
import OAuthServer, { OAuthError, UnauthorizedRequestError } from '@node-oauth/oauth2-server';
12
import { OAuthApps, Users } from '@rocket.chat/models';
23
import express from 'express';
34
import type { Express, NextFunction, Request, Response } from 'express';
45
import { Accounts } from 'meteor/accounts-base';
5-
import OAuthServer, { OAuthError, UnauthorizedRequestError } from 'oauth2-server';
66

77
import type { ModelConfig } from './model';
88
import { Model } from './model';

yarn.lock

Lines changed: 27 additions & 65 deletions
Original file line numberDiff line numberDiff line change
@@ -4599,6 +4599,24 @@ __metadata:
45994599
languageName: node
46004600
linkType: hard
46014601

4602+
"@node-oauth/formats@npm:1.0.0":
4603+
version: 1.0.0
4604+
resolution: "@node-oauth/formats@npm:1.0.0"
4605+
checksum: 10/354f11d38dacc8ba64666132ae6cd27f390a55d3dcfc983a7f9514de7b08707ec8b0753ce2140c639b9a342b595d41e3f591a23e3122ccc17af155179b26eac5
4606+
languageName: node
4607+
linkType: hard
4608+
4609+
"@node-oauth/oauth2-server@npm:5.2.0":
4610+
version: 5.2.0
4611+
resolution: "@node-oauth/oauth2-server@npm:5.2.0"
4612+
dependencies:
4613+
"@node-oauth/formats": "npm:1.0.0"
4614+
basic-auth: "npm:2.0.1"
4615+
type-is: "npm:1.6.18"
4616+
checksum: 10/0ae8b1a1fb175699a813d865a01da45aa9daa12619b9e8d1e0981ca081eb617e64444e2ce4af0d22a052719e3002bb937f37085d4a51622e560752d74cad5733
4617+
languageName: node
4618+
linkType: hard
4619+
46024620
"@nodelib/fs.scandir@npm:2.1.5":
46034621
version: 2.1.5
46044622
resolution: "@nodelib/fs.scandir@npm:2.1.5"
@@ -8270,6 +8288,7 @@ __metadata:
82708288
"@nivo/heatmap": "npm:0.88.0"
82718289
"@nivo/line": "npm:0.88.0"
82728290
"@nivo/pie": "npm:0.88.0"
8291+
"@node-oauth/oauth2-server": "npm:5.2.0"
82738292
"@opentelemetry/api": "npm:^1.9.0"
82748293
"@opentelemetry/exporter-trace-otlp-grpc": "npm:^0.54.2"
82758294
"@opentelemetry/sdk-node": "npm:^0.54.2"
@@ -8552,7 +8571,6 @@ __metadata:
85528571
node-rsa: "npm:^1.1.1"
85538572
nodemailer: "npm:^6.9.16"
85548573
nyc: "npm:^15.1.0"
8555-
oauth2-server: "npm:3.1.1"
85568574
object-path: "npm:^0.11.8"
85578575
outdent: "npm:~0.8.0"
85588576
path: "npm:^0.12.7"
@@ -15170,20 +15188,13 @@ __metadata:
1517015188
languageName: node
1517115189
linkType: hard
1517215190

15173-
"bluebird@npm:3.7.2, bluebird@npm:^3.1.5, bluebird@npm:^3.5.0":
15191+
"bluebird@npm:^3.1.5, bluebird@npm:^3.5.0":
1517415192
version: 3.7.2
1517515193
resolution: "bluebird@npm:3.7.2"
1517615194
checksum: 10/007c7bad22c5d799c8dd49c85b47d012a1fe3045be57447721e6afbd1d5be43237af1db62e26cb9b0d9ba812d2e4ca3bac82f6d7e016b6b88de06ee25ceb96e7
1517715195
languageName: node
1517815196
linkType: hard
1517915197

15180-
"bluebird@npm:^2.10.0":
15181-
version: 2.11.0
15182-
resolution: "bluebird@npm:2.11.0"
15183-
checksum: 10/f8271257f248f3a95caa3b54a99c96c91132f6d62c2b2aa367bc63bab6e3b9a240ae6a95d893f70715ef52647af9d4e4afe0a04267c31c94cc5873d2add96a3b
15184-
languageName: node
15185-
linkType: hard
15186-
1518715198
"blueimp-md5@npm:^2.16.0":
1518815199
version: 2.19.0
1518915200
resolution: "blueimp-md5@npm:2.19.0"
@@ -16502,23 +16513,6 @@ __metadata:
1650216513
languageName: node
1650316514
linkType: hard
1650416515

16505-
"co-bluebird@npm:^1.1.0":
16506-
version: 1.1.0
16507-
resolution: "co-bluebird@npm:1.1.0"
16508-
dependencies:
16509-
bluebird: "npm:^2.10.0"
16510-
co-use: "npm:^1.1.0"
16511-
checksum: 10/d78e6d05ccd531fb5fc644a263dd9b3d62137f0b5c7e869ce5d22301fc9cddeeba953f625170e157de8629a05d1e11fbecf85a5582b5fb3c86afe78b7a85c2c5
16512-
languageName: node
16513-
linkType: hard
16514-
16515-
"co-use@npm:^1.1.0":
16516-
version: 1.1.0
16517-
resolution: "co-use@npm:1.1.0"
16518-
checksum: 10/b71977870ad31b23236d72cc283742adad810838aa89c326dbc0afe2272ff4ddb282c8ca0668ba151ab0d090264fb0a01ceb600e434261a6cce5ccc080bd1654
16519-
languageName: node
16520-
linkType: hard
16521-
1652216516
"co@npm:^4.6.0":
1652316517
version: 4.6.0
1652416518
resolution: "co@npm:4.6.0"
@@ -23491,13 +23485,6 @@ __metadata:
2349123485
languageName: node
2349223486
linkType: hard
2349323487

23494-
"is-generator@npm:^1.0.2":
23495-
version: 1.0.3
23496-
resolution: "is-generator@npm:1.0.3"
23497-
checksum: 10/416ab44184fcb75923fd07cdffd05cbfc27c13d75ab9d5df441180f9689def4ba4e430a249b1b39669c651e9ea697c107493391e8265ab78ffe22e5eafb34c6b
23498-
languageName: node
23499-
linkType: hard
23500-
2350123488
"is-gif@npm:^3.0.0":
2350223489
version: 3.0.0
2350323490
resolution: "is-gif@npm:3.0.0"
@@ -27954,20 +27941,6 @@ __metadata:
2795427941
languageName: node
2795527942
linkType: hard
2795627943

27957-
"oauth2-server@npm:3.1.1":
27958-
version: 3.1.1
27959-
resolution: "oauth2-server@npm:3.1.1"
27960-
dependencies:
27961-
basic-auth: "npm:2.0.1"
27962-
bluebird: "npm:3.7.2"
27963-
lodash: "npm:4.17.19"
27964-
promisify-any: "npm:2.0.1"
27965-
statuses: "npm:1.5.0"
27966-
type-is: "npm:1.6.18"
27967-
checksum: 10/5038ca4101ab869e76d66c5819636ddca57b8adc2816ccddb7897ac156d25b107528a8f1ea2acfe8e8071350878e7beda639c4c45165fd78cf6397de0d736edf
27968-
languageName: node
27969-
linkType: hard
27970-
2797127944
"object-assign@npm:^4, object-assign@npm:^4.0.1, object-assign@npm:^4.1.0, object-assign@npm:^4.1.1":
2797227945
version: 4.1.1
2797327946
resolution: "object-assign@npm:4.1.1"
@@ -30300,17 +30273,6 @@ __metadata:
3030030273
languageName: node
3030130274
linkType: hard
3030230275

30303-
"promisify-any@npm:2.0.1":
30304-
version: 2.0.1
30305-
resolution: "promisify-any@npm:2.0.1"
30306-
dependencies:
30307-
bluebird: "npm:^2.10.0"
30308-
co-bluebird: "npm:^1.1.0"
30309-
is-generator: "npm:^1.0.2"
30310-
checksum: 10/304f5834a53f25d8d8949f7d43e579142fcf041861fafe5618e375b9679db0b953b6401f42c32b14d921a051fd9aef430df647f1e278135ef93456da52b4544b
30311-
languageName: node
30312-
linkType: hard
30313-
3031430276
"prompts@npm:^2.0.1":
3031530277
version: 2.4.2
3031630278
resolution: "prompts@npm:2.4.2"
@@ -33451,20 +33413,20 @@ __metadata:
3345133413
languageName: node
3345233414
linkType: hard
3345333415

33454-
"statuses@npm:1.5.0, statuses@npm:>= 1.4.0 < 2, statuses@npm:~1.5.0":
33455-
version: 1.5.0
33456-
resolution: "statuses@npm:1.5.0"
33457-
checksum: 10/c469b9519de16a4bb19600205cffb39ee471a5f17b82589757ca7bd40a8d92ebb6ed9f98b5a540c5d302ccbc78f15dc03cc0280dd6e00df1335568a5d5758a5c
33458-
languageName: node
33459-
linkType: hard
33460-
3346133416
"statuses@npm:2.0.1, statuses@npm:^2.0.1":
3346233417
version: 2.0.1
3346333418
resolution: "statuses@npm:2.0.1"
3346433419
checksum: 10/18c7623fdb8f646fb213ca4051be4df7efb3484d4ab662937ca6fbef7ced9b9e12842709872eb3020cc3504b93bde88935c9f6417489627a7786f24f8031cbcb
3346533420
languageName: node
3346633421
linkType: hard
3346733422

33423+
"statuses@npm:>= 1.4.0 < 2, statuses@npm:~1.5.0":
33424+
version: 1.5.0
33425+
resolution: "statuses@npm:1.5.0"
33426+
checksum: 10/c469b9519de16a4bb19600205cffb39ee471a5f17b82589757ca7bd40a8d92ebb6ed9f98b5a540c5d302ccbc78f15dc03cc0280dd6e00df1335568a5d5758a5c
33427+
languageName: node
33428+
linkType: hard
33429+
3346833430
"stealthy-require@npm:^1.1.1":
3346933431
version: 1.1.1
3347033432
resolution: "stealthy-require@npm:1.1.1"

0 commit comments

Comments
 (0)